A staging site is essentially a clone of your live site. It serves as a testing ground where you can trial new features, updates, and plugins before implementing them on your live site. This ensures that any changes do not disrupt the user experience or break the site.
Purpose and Benefits
The primary advantage of a staging environment is the ability to experiment without risk. If something goes pear-shaped, your live site remains unaffected, allowing you to address issues in a controlled setting. This isolation is crucial for maintaining the integrity and functionality of your live site.
Moreover, staging sites aid in identifying potential conflicts with existing plugins or themes. By testing in a separate environment, you can pinpoint issues and resolve them without impacting live users. This proactive approach minimises downtime and enhances user experience.
Different Types of Staging Environments
There are various types of staging environments to consider, each with its unique features and benefits. Local staging environments, for instance, allow developers to test changes on their computers without affecting online resources. This type offers a high level of flexibility and control.
On the other hand, remote staging environments hosted by your service provider offer the advantage of replicating the live server conditions more accurately. This setup is particularly beneficial for testing server-specific features and configurations. By understanding the differences, you can choose the right environment for your needs.
Common Pitfalls and How to Avoid Them
Creating a staging environment isn’t without its challenges. One common pitfall is forgetting to synchronise the staging environment with the latest live site data. This oversight can lead to testing outdated features and missing crucial bugs.
Regular synchronisation is essential for accurate testing.
Another common issue is neglecting security measures on the staging site. Even though it’s not live, a staging site can still be vulnerable to attacks. Implementing security best practices such as password protection and limiting access is crucial to safeguarding your testing environment.
Why Avoid Overwriting the Database?
The database is the backbone of your WordPress site, storing everything from user data to site content and settings. Overwriting it can result in data loss, including crucial customer information and content updates. Thus, pushing a staging site without overwriting the database preserves these elements, ensuring continuity and integrity.
The Risks of Overwriting
Overwriting the database can have disastrous consequences. It can lead to the loss of recent content updates, user comments, and even customer transactions.
Such losses can affect the credibility and functionality of your website, leading to potential revenue loss and user dissatisfaction.
Furthermore, overwriting can also cause inconsistencies between the database and the live site files. This desynchronisation can result in broken links, missing images, and a host of other issues that degrade user experience. Avoiding overwriting preserves the coherence between your site’s files and its database.
Maintaining Data Integrity
Maintaining data integrity is crucial for the smooth operation of your WordPress site. Ensuring that database entries are consistent and accurate helps in delivering a seamless experience to your users. By avoiding overwriting, you safeguard the integrity of your database, ensuring all data is accurate and up to date.
Additionally, data integrity is essential for search engine optimisation (SEO).
Inconsistencies in your database can lead to incorrect meta tags, broken links, and other issues that negatively impact your site’s SEO performance. By preserving your database, you ensure that your site remains optimised for search engines.
Alternatives to Database Overwriting
There are several alternatives to overwriting your database, each offering its unique benefits. Incremental database updates, for instance, allow you to apply changes without affecting the entire database. This approach minimises the risk of data loss and maintains the integrity of your site.
Another alternative is using database synchronisation tools that compare the staging and live databases, applying only necessary changes. These tools automate the process, reducing the risk of human error and ensuring that only relevant updates are applied. By exploring these alternatives, you can find a solution that best fits your needs.
How to Create a WordPress Staging Site
Before delving into the particulars of implementing changes without impacting the database, it’s crucial to understand how to set up a staging site.
Manual Staging Site Creation
Creating a staging site manually involves several steps:
- Back-up Your Live Site: Always begin by making a back-up of your current site. Utilise plugins like UpdraftPlus or rely on your hosting provider’s back-up solutions. A back-up acts as a safety net, allowing you to restore your site in case anything goes wrong.
- Create a Subdomain: Most hosting services permit you to create a subdomain (e.g., staging.yoursite.com) for your staging site. This subdomain acts as a separate environment where you can test changes without affecting your live site.
- Duplicate Your Site Files: Copy all files from your live site to the subdomain directory.
This duplication ensures that your staging site mirrors the live site, providing a realistic testing environment. 4. Clone the Database: Export your live database using phpMyAdmin and import it into a new database for the staging site. This step is crucial for replicating the live site’s data and settings accurately. 5. Configure wp-config.php: Edit the wp-config.php file to point to the new database and subdomain. This configuration ensures that your staging site connects to the correct database, maintaining the integrity of your testing environment.
Using Plugins for Staging
Numerous plugins can simplify the staging process. Plugins like WP Staging and Duplicator streamline the creation of a staging environment without the need for manual file and database handling.
WP Staging, for instance, allows you to create a staging site with a single click, automating the file and database duplication process.
This simplicity makes it an excellent choice for those new to WordPress development.
Duplicator, on the other hand, offers more advanced features such as scheduled backups and migrations. This plugin is ideal for developers who require more control over the staging process. By utilising these tools, you can simplify staging site creation and focus on testing and development.

Pushing Staging Site Without Overwriting the Database
Once your staging site is set up and your amendments are ready to be pushed live, follow these steps to ensure the database remains untouched:
Step 1: Backup Your Live Database
Before making any changes, ensure you have a backup of your live database. This step is non-negotiable and acts as a safety net should anything go wrong. A backup allows you to restore your database to its prior state, minimising potential data loss.
Regular backups are essential for maintaining the integrity of your site. By scheduling automatic backups, you can ensure that you always have a recent copy of your database available. This proactive approach reduces the risk of data loss and enhances site stability.
Step 2: Isolate Changes
The key to pushing changes without impacting the database lies in isolating the changes to files only.
This involves:
- Theme Files: If changes are limited to themes, copy only the theme files from the staging site to the live site. This targeted approach minimises the risk of unintended changes affecting other site elements.
- Plugins: For plugin updates or installations, ensure only plugin files are transferred. This isolation prevents database overwriting and ensures that the live site’s functionality remains intact.
- Custom Code: Any custom code or script changes should be transferred separately. By isolating these changes, you can ensure that only the necessary modifications are applied to the live site.
Step 3: Use a File Comparison Tool
Tools like Beyond Compare or Meld can be used to identify file differences between the staging and live environments, ensuring only necessary changes are applied. These tools provide a visual representation of file differences, making it easy to spot discrepancies and apply targeted changes.
File comparison tools are particularly useful for large sites with numerous files. By automating the comparison process, these tools reduce the risk of human error and ensure that only relevant changes are made. This precision enhances site stability and performance.
Step 4: Implement Changes
Transfer the isolated files to the live server using FTP or via your hosting provider’s file manager. Be meticulous in this step to ensure no unintended files are transferred. A careful transfer process minimises the risk of errors and ensures that your site remains functional and stable.
Consider using a version control system like Git to track changes and revert them if necessary. Git provides a granular level of control over file modifications, allowing you to manage changes with confidence. By leveraging version control, you can enhance the reliability of your deployment process.
Step 5: Test Thoroughly
After applying changes, conduct a thorough test of your live site to confirm functionality. Check for broken links, missing images, and overall site performance. Comprehensive testing ensures that your site functions as expected and delivers a seamless user experience.
Consider using automated testing tools to streamline this process. Tools like Selenium permit you to run automated test scripts, reducing the time and effort required for manual testing. By automating testing, you can identify and resolve issues more efficiently, enhancing site performance.
Advanced Techniques and Tools
For those looking to streamline this process further, advanced tools and techniques can automate many of these steps.
Version Control with Git
Implementing version control systems like Git can offer more granular control over changes.
Git allows you to track modifications, revert changes if necessary, and collaborate seamlessly with other developers. This level of control is invaluable for managing complex development projects.
Git also enhances collaboration by providing a centralised repository for all changes. This repository allows multiple developers to work on the same project simultaneously, reducing development time and increasing efficiency. By adopting version control, you can streamline your development process and improve project outcomes.
Deployment Tools
Consider utilising deployment tools such as DeployBot or Buddy. These tools facilitate automated deployments, reducing the risk of human error and ensuring a smooth transition from staging to live environments. Automated deployments save time and resources, allowing you to focus on development and testing.
Deployment tools also offer features like rollback and error notifications, enhancing deployment reliability.
By automating deployments, you can minimise downtime and ensure that your site remains functional and accessible to users. This automation enhances site performance and user experience.
Continuous Integration and Delivery (CI/CD)
Continuous Integration and Delivery (CI/CD) is an advanced approach that automates the entire development and deployment process. CI/CD tools like Jenkins and Travis CI integrate seamlessly with version control systems, automating testing and deployment.
By adopting CI/CD, you can ensure that changes are tested and deployed automatically, reducing the risk of human error and enhancing site stability. This approach allows you to deliver updates more frequently and reliably, improving site performance and user satisfaction.
